Customized software solutions offer businesses an effective tool to drive innovation in today's fast-paced business world, offering unparalleled functionality while aligning technology and business goals harmoniously.
Custom solutions differ from mass market software by being created with scalability in mind, which enables businesses to easily adapt to changing business demands.
Cost-effectiveness
Custom software development enables businesses to meet their unique challenges and requirements with tailor-made solutions that address them efficiently and cost effectively. This can improve operational efficiencies, gain competitive edge in the market, comply with industry standards, as well as secure their software - however custom development costs tend to be higher due to higher initial development expenses as well as ongoing support services required for such solutions.
Businesses looking to maximize cost-effectiveness should engage in an intensive discovery process, working closely with stakeholders and users to identify desired results for any custom software project. This will help define project objectives more clearly while providing direction to development teams.
Additionally, businesses should assess the potential advantages and costs of custom software before weighing these against its initial cost. They should consider whether using custom software will enhance customer satisfaction and loyalty; this will allow for a return on investment analysis and allow informed decisions regarding using custom software within business operations.
Flexibility
Custom software development offers several distinct advantages over off-the-shelf solutions, such as seamless integration into an organization's existing systems and databases to streamline workflows and ensure data consistency. Furthermore, it can be tailored specifically to address security needs for cyber threats that threaten businesses today.
Custom software offers businesses another advantage - its scalability. Businesses can easily adapt the system to meet changing business requirements without impacting functionality or performance - giving businesses greater operational efficiencies, competitive advantages and improved productivity.
Functional testing is a cornerstone of custom software development. This stage involves rigorous examinations for bugs and security vulnerabilities to ensure that the final software meets quality standards and can be deployed without issue. Product managers face a daunting challenge in this step - they must balance innovation with producing secure, stable applications while still being innovative enough for launch. A great way to do this successfully is keeping team members involved during discussions and planning sessions.
Security
An effective cybersecurity strategy is an integral component of software development. This approach seeks to identify and address security vulnerabilities before they are exploited by hackers, as well as creating a formal policy for integrating security throughout the SDLC process in order to minimize vulnerability risk in software production.
Cyber attacks pose an existential threat to businesses that process sensitive data. Such attacks can damage reputation, result in financial losses, decreased productivity and the theft of intellectual property rights; furthermore they may disrupt operations leading to expensive operational disruptions and recovery processes.
Custom software solutions can help reduce these risks by implementing stringent security measures and ensuring seamless integration with existing systems and infrastructure. At Jain Software, we place great importance on security in software development utilizing best practices such as secure coding, encryption, and data protection.
Innovation
Custom software asd.team development provides businesses with unique challenges and growth aspirations a tailored solution that helps achieve strategic objectives without compromising functionality or efficiency. Custom systems are flexible enough to change with expansion plans while meeting unique compliance standards, all designed with the goal of improving business operations to increase profitability.
Custom software development is an orchestra of creativity, collaboration, and execution. From ideation through final product launch, each phase plays a vital role in turning ideas into impactful solutions that drive digital transformation and business success. This journey starts by outlining clear requirements in coherent blueprints for any development project; user stories may help maintain clarity throughout this process.